California Common is the official name given to this beer style since our "friends" and mentors across the bay trademarked the true name for it. But we don't hate, we just recreate! So here it is, the Common Lager, brewed in the same fashion and spirit as ALL of the Steam Beer breweries of the 19th century. Ours is a golden interpretation of the style, which is typically brewed more copper in color. We figured, "What does copper have to do with California?" and chose to produce a version more fitting for a state known as... uh... well, the GOLDEN state. The Common is malt forward with a nice hop finish that leaves you satisfied in a way that typical lagers can't. Most importantly though, it is your chance to imagine what the beers around here tasted like back in the day!
